summaryrefslogtreecommitdiff
path: root/RELEASE-NOTES
diff options
context:
space:
mode:
authorDaniel Stenberg <daniel@haxx.se>2022-09-14 09:58:50 +0200
committerDaniel Stenberg <daniel@haxx.se>2022-09-14 09:58:50 +0200
commit2b59f9f9ea3dd6de9222fedd57d5caf0e624da9e (patch)
treee44ecec7de74b77df063fe99691132f8c48c7698 /RELEASE-NOTES
parent889c132c38a4920b0ae009f0330a8b905eee83a3 (diff)
downloadcurl-2b59f9f9ea3dd6de9222fedd57d5caf0e624da9e.tar.gz
RELEASE-NOTES: synced
Diffstat (limited to 'RELEASE-NOTES')
-rw-r--r--RELEASE-NOTES43
1 files changed, 35 insertions, 8 deletions
diff --git a/RELEASE-NOTES b/RELEASE-NOTES
index 3cc42ddae..788f34279 100644
--- a/RELEASE-NOTES
+++ b/RELEASE-NOTES
@@ -2,9 +2,9 @@ curl and libcurl 7.86.0
Public curl releases: 211
Command line options: 248
- curl_easy_setopt() options: 299
- Public functions in libcurl: 88
- Contributors: 2696
+ curl_easy_setopt() options: 300
+ Public functions in libcurl: 91
+ Contributors: 2699
This release includes the following changes:
@@ -13,6 +13,7 @@ This release includes the following changes:
This release includes the following bugfixes:
+ o cmake: define BUILDING_LIBCURL in lib/CMakeLists, not config.h [5]
o cmake: fix original MinGW builds [177]
o configure: correct the wording when checking grep -E [13]
o configure: fail if '--without-ssl' + explicit parameter for an ssl lib [164]
@@ -21,25 +22,37 @@ This release includes the following bugfixes:
o curl-compilers.m4: use -O2 as default optimize for clang [6]
o curl_ctype: convert to macros-only [10]
o curl_easy_pause.3: unpausing is as fast as possible [14]
+ o curl_setup: include curl.h after platform setup headers [37]
+ o curl_setup: include only system.h instead of curl.h [34]
o CURLOPT_DNS_INTERFACE.3: mention it works for almost all protocols [15]
o CURLOPT_PROXY_SSLCERT_BLOB.3: this is for HTTPS proxies [9]
o CURLOPT_WILDCARDMATCH.3: Fix backslash escaping under single quotes [172]
+ o docs: correct missing uppercase in Markdown files [38]
o docs: remove mentions of deprecated '--without-openssl' parameter [170]
+ o formdata: fix warning: 'CURLformoption' is promoted to 'int' [24]
o ftp: ignore a 550 response to MDTM [1]
+ o getparameter: return PARAM_MANUAL_REQUESTED for -M even when disabled [17]
o header: define public API functions as extern c [26]
o headers: reset the requests counter at transfer start [25]
o http2: make nghttp2 less picky about field whitespace [27]
+ o lib: add missing limits.h includes [35]
o lib: add required Win32 setup definitions in setup-win32.h [4]
o manpages: Fix spelling of "allows to" -> "allows one to" [171]
o misc: ISSPACE() => ISBLANK() [11]
o misc: spelling fixes [174]
+ o RELEASE-PROCEDURE.md: mention patch releases [21]
+ o scripts: use `grep -E` instead of `egrep` [30]
o setup-win32: no longer define UNICODE/_UNICODE implicitly [3]
o tests/certs/scripts: insert standard curl source headers [169]
o tests: fix tag syntax errors in test files
+ o tool_hugehelp: make hugehelp a blank macro when disabled [7]
+ o tool_operate: avoid a few #ifdefs for disabled-libcurl builds [29]
o tool_operate: prevent over-queuing in parallel mode [176]
o tool_operate: reduce errorbuffer allocs [173]
o tool_progress: remove 'Qd' from the parallel progress bar [175]
+ o tool_setopt: use better English in --libcurl source comments [39]
o urlapi: leaner with fewer allocs [2]
+ o wolfSSL: fix session management bug. [31]
This release includes the following known bugs:
@@ -48,12 +61,13 @@ This release includes the following known bugs:
This release would not have looked like this without help, code, reports and
advice from friends like these:
- ajak in #curl, Andrew Lambert, Dan Fandrich, Daniel Stenberg, Emanuele Torre,
- James Fuller, justchen1369 on github, Keitagit-kun on github, Marcel Raad,
- Marc Hörsken, Max Dymond, Michael Heimpold, Orgad Shaneh, Patrick Monnerat,
+ a1346054 on github, ajak in #curl, Andrew Lambert, Benjamin Loison,
+ Dan Fandrich, Daniel Stenberg, Emanuele Torre, Hayden Roche, James Fuller,
+ justchen1369 on github, Keitagit-kun on github, Marcel Raad, Marc Hörsken,
+ Max Dymond, Michael Heimpold, Orgad Shaneh, Patrick Monnerat, Philip Heiduck,
ProceduralMan on github, Ray Satiro, Samuel Henrique, ssdbest on github,
- Viktor Szakats
- (19 contributors)
+ Viktor Szakats, zhanghu on xiaomi
+ (24 contributors)
References to bug reports and discussions on issues:
@@ -61,7 +75,9 @@ References to bug reports and discussions on issues:
[2] = https://curl.se/bug/?i=9408
[3] = https://curl.se/bug/?i=9375
[4] = https://curl.se/bug/?i=9375
+ [5] = https://curl.se/bug/?i=9498
[6] = https://curl.se/bug/?i=9444
+ [7] = https://curl.se/bug/?i=9485
[8] = https://curl.se/bug/?i=9455
[9] = https://curl.se/bug/?i=9434
[10] = https://curl.se/bug/?i=9429
@@ -71,10 +87,21 @@ References to bug reports and discussions on issues:
[14] = https://curl.se/bug/?i=9410
[15] = https://curl.se/bug/?i=9427
[16] = https://curl.se/bug/?i=9307
+ [17] = https://curl.se/bug/?i=9485
+ [21] = https://curl.se/bug/?i=9495
[23] = https://curl.se/bug/?i=8995
+ [24] = https://curl.se/bug/?i=9484
[25] = https://curl.se/bug/?i=9424
[26] = https://curl.se/bug/?i=9424
[27] = https://curl.se/bug/?i=9448
+ [29] = https://curl.se/bug/?i=9486
+ [30] = https://curl.se/bug/?i=9491
+ [31] = https://curl.se/bug/?i=9492
+ [34] = https://curl.se/bug/?i=9453
+ [35] = https://curl.se/bug/?i=9453
+ [37] = https://curl.se/bug/?i=9453
+ [38] = https://curl.se/bug/?i=9474
+ [39] = https://curl.se/bug/?i=9475
[164] = https://curl.se/bug/?i=9414
[169] = https://curl.se/bug/?i=9417
[170] = https://curl.se/bug/?i=9415